National Pickling is the classic American pickling cucumber — a high-yielding, early variety that bears prolifically on short, space-saving vines and has been a staple of home canning and pickling for generations. Medium green fruits bear early and set heavily, with a crisp texture and clean flavor that makes them ideal for lacto-fermented dill pickles, bread-and-butter pickles, and any home preserving project. Fertilize well and pick frequently at a small size to maintain good color and fruit shape. 57 days.
Direct sow outdoors after last frost when soil has warmed to at least 60°F, or start indoors 3–4 weeks before last frost. Sow seeds 1 inch deep in fertile, well-draining soil. Fertilize well and frequently. Space plants 12–18 inches apart in full sun. Trellis or stake vines. Water consistently. Pick frequently at small size for best color and shape.
